## Branch Cleanup Bot

Tidewick runs an automated bot called Sweeprake against all repositories in the Lanternfall org. Any branch with no commits in 60 days is flagged; after a 14-day grace period it is archived to a tag and deleted. Protected branches and anything matching release/* are exempt. You'll get a notification before deletion, so keep an eye on your repo activity feed. If the bot removes something you still need, restoration requests go to the platform team.

escalation mailbox, bafog-fafog: ulador@paliqlabs.internal

Each print job moves through queued, claimed, rendering, and dispatched states, and transitions are enforced by the Ledgerlock state machine — reviewers should reject any PR that mutates state outside of it. Pay particular attention to the retry semantics for stalled renderers, since double-dispatch has bitten us twice. The architecture decision records, sequence diagrams, and reviewer checklist are collected on the internal page below.

operations page: https://jenkins.zemvarcloud.local/job/merge_requests/repo/build/73930b4b30f0a8ed

14:22 — Offline sync regression confirmed (Terrapath field-survey app)

At 14:22 the on-call engineer reproduced the data-loss path: surveys saved while offline were marked synced once connectivity returned, even when the upload was rejected. The queue flush skipped the server acknowledgement check introduced in the previous sprint. Release manager note: the fix must ship before the coastal survey season. The offending build is identified by the token recorded below.

session token of kawif-fawig = htk31_f3f599be2b1a34affb1efa8d0feccf8

# TaxPeek Cache — Session Handling

Welcome aboard! TaxPeek caches regional tax rates for the Billow checkout flow. Sessions are short-lived: each lookup client grabs a session, pulls rates, and drops it. Don't hold sessions across requests — the cache invalidates them after 90 seconds, and you'll get stale-rate warnings.

For local testing against the sandbox cache, authenticate your session with the bearer token below.

login token, bagug-kafop: eyJhbGciOiJIUzI1NiIsInR5cCI6IkpXVCJ9.eyJzdWIiOiIcMLov2In0.Z5RLDIfp